Steamboat Springs’ 80487 sits in the Yampa Valley with a laid-back, ranching-meets-ski-town vibe. Days revolve around Steamboat Resort and historic Howelsen Hill, hot soaks at Strawberry Park and Old Town Hot Springs, and summers of wildflower hikes, Emerald Mountain biking, fly-fishing, and tubing the Yampa. Winters are snowy and bright; summers bring warm days and cool nights.
Downtown Lincoln Avenue anchors daily life: coffee at Off the Beaten Path or Big Iron, dinner at Aurum, Laundry, or Salt & Lime, and live music at Schmiggity’s. Pints pour at Storm Peak and Mountain Tap; groceries are easy at City Market, Safeway, and Natural Grocers, plus shops at Wildhorse Marketplace and Steamboat Square. Green escapes include the Yampa River Core Trail, Botanic Park, Fish Creek Falls, and the off‑leash Rita Valentine Park; the free bus keeps it connected. Can I submit a Portable Tenant Screening Report when I apply?
Applicant has the right to provide 1610 Mustang Run with a Portable Tenant Screening Report (PTSR), as defined in §38-12-902(2.5), Colorado Revised Statutes; and 2) if Applicant provides 1610 Mustang Run with a PTSR, 1610 Mustang Run is prohibited from: a) charging Applicant a rental application fee; or b) charging Applicant a fee for 1610 Mustang Run to access or use the PTSR. 1610 Mustang Run may limit acceptance of PTSRs to those that are not more than 30 days old.
